The Evolution of Flight Simulation: From Hardware to Virtual Reality
Historically, flight simulators have ranged from basic mechanical devices to cutting-edge full-motion simulators used by commercial airlines and military programs. According to the International Civil Aviation Organization (ICAO), the deployment of Ground-Based Procedure Trainers (GPT) and Full Flight Simulators (FFS) has been crucial in meeting rigorous safety standards.
However, recent years have witnessed a seismic shift towards digital simulation—leveraging advanced graphics, real-time physics, and virtual reality (VR) to create more accessible and versatile training environments. These innovations enable tailored scenario planning, rapid iteration, and cost-efficient training modules with measurable impact on pilot proficiency and safety metrics.
Industry Insights: Data-Driven Impact of Digital Aviation Simulations
| Parameter | Traditional Simulations | Digital Virtual Platforms |
|---|---|---|
| Training Cost per Hour | £2,000 – £5,000 | £500 – £1,500 |
| Scenario Flexibility | Limited to physical setups | Near-limitless customization |
| Training Accessibility | Restricted to specialised centres | Remote, cloud-based options |
| Retention & Recall | Moderate | Enhanced through immersive VR experiences |
Industry reports from Aviation Week indicate that digital simulation adoption has resulted in 25–30% reductions in training costs, while also elevating scenario realism—crucial in crisis management training. Moreover, airlines such as Qatar Airways and Emirates are pioneering initiatives to embed virtual reality into pilot onboarding programs, thus accelerating competency development.
Where the Industry Is Heading: The Role of Emerging Technologies
Looking forward, several key innovations are poised to redefine digital aviation training:
- Artificial Intelligence (AI): Customised scenario adjustment, predictive analytics on pilot responses
- Augmented Reality (AR): On-the-job assistance, real-time data overlays
- Cloud Computing: Scalable, remote access to complex simulation modules
- Haptic Feedback Devices: Enhanced tactile immersion for better skill transfer
The integration of such technologies underscores the aviation sector’s commitment to safety, efficiency, and innovation.
